Server Maintenance Checklist: Avoid Downtime With 2026 Tips

December 19, 2025

IT security agent working on his powerhouse software.

Keeping your servers healthy is critical to your business operations. Without regular maintenance, you risk data loss, security breaches, and costly downtime. In this guide, you’ll learn how to build a reliable server maintenance checklist, what tasks to prioritize, and how to apply best practices for both Windows and Linux servers. We’ll also cover tools, tips, and templates to help your server run smoothly and avoid hardware failure.

[.c-button-wrap][.c-button-main][.c-button-icon-content]Contact Us[.c-button-icon][.c-button-icon][.c-button-icon-content][.c-button-main][.c-button-wrap]

What is a server maintenance checklist and why it matters

A server maintenance checklist is a set of routine tasks designed to keep your servers secure, updated, and performing at their best. Whether you're managing a single server or a full server room, having a structured approach ensures nothing critical is overlooked.

Regular maintenance helps prevent unexpected downtime, improves server performance, and extends the life of your hardware. It also ensures compliance with security standards and reduces the risk of data loss. Without a checklist, it’s easy to forget essential tasks like checking server logs or updating your operating system (OS).

IT professional checking server maintenance checklist

Key steps to include in your server maintenance checklist

A strong checklist covers everything from updates to backups. Here are the most important steps to include:

Step #1: Schedule regular updates

Apply software updates and patches to your OS and applications. This protects your server from known vulnerabilities and ensures compatibility with other tools. Set a recurring schedule to avoid delays.

Step #2: Perform data backups

Backups are your safety net. Make sure you back up critical data daily and test your restore process regularly. Use both onsite and offsite solutions for redundancy. You can learn more about data backup best practices to ensure your data is secure.

Step #3: Monitor server logs

Reviewing logs helps you spot unusual activity early. Look for login attempts, service errors, and performance issues. Automate log monitoring when possible.

Step #4: Check disk space and usage

Running out of disk space can crash your server. Monitor disk usage and clean up unnecessary files. Set alerts for when usage hits critical levels.

Step #5: Test server performance

Use built-in tools or third-party software to measure CPU, memory, and network usage. Identify bottlenecks and optimize workloads accordingly.

Step #6: Verify server security settings

Check firewall rules, antivirus software, and user permissions. Update passwords regularly and disable unused accounts to reduce risk.

Step #7: Review hardware health

Inspect server hardware for signs of wear. Check fans, power supplies, and hard drives. Replace failing components before they cause downtime.

Essential features of a reliable maintenance process

A good maintenance process includes these key features:

  • Clear documentation of all tasks and schedules
  • Automated alerts for performance or security issues
  • Secure access through a control panel or remote tools
  • Regular testing of backup and recovery processes
  • Role-based access to limit who can make changes
  • Integration with server management platforms
IT professional inspecting server maintenance checklist

How to use a server maintenance checklist template effectively

Using a server maintenance checklist template saves time and ensures consistency. Templates help you standardize tasks across multiple servers and team members. Whether you manage Windows Server or Linux Server environments, a template ensures nothing is missed.

Customize your template based on your server type, business needs, and compliance requirements. For example, Linux servers may need different commands or log paths than Windows servers. Keep your checklist updated as your infrastructure evolves.

Tools and strategies to improve server maintenance

The right tools and strategies make server maintenance easier and more effective. Here are some worth considering:

Tool #1: Remote management tools

These let you access and manage servers from anywhere. Look for tools that support secure connections and multi-server environments.

Tool #2: Automated patch management

Automating updates reduces human error and ensures timely patching. Choose tools that support both OS and third-party software.

Tool #3: Disk cleanup utilities

Use these to remove temporary files, logs, and unused software. This helps free up space and improve performance.

Tool #4: Server monitoring dashboards

Dashboards give you real-time visibility into server resource usage. They help you spot trends and respond quickly to issues.

Tool #5: Password management systems

Securely store and rotate passwords for server access. This reduces the risk of unauthorized entry and simplifies audits.

Tool #6: Maintenance schedule automation

Automate recurring tasks like reboots, backups, and updates. This ensures consistency and reduces manual workload.

IT technician organizing server maintenance checklist

Practical steps to implement your checklist

Start by reviewing your current server setup. Identify gaps in your maintenance process and prioritize high-risk areas like backups and updates. Then, build or customize a checklist that fits your environment.

Assign responsibilities to your IT team and set a clear maintenance schedule. Use monitoring tools to track compliance and performance. Review and update your checklist quarterly to keep it aligned with business needs and technology changes.

Best practices for server monitoring and maintenance

Follow these best practices to keep your servers in top shape:

  • Monitor server resource usage daily to catch performance issues early
  • Use our server maintenance checklist to standardize tasks
  • Limit access to the server room and secure physical hardware
  • Review server logs weekly to detect unusual activity
  • Apply server maintenance tips from trusted sources
  • Document every change to your server hardware or software

These practices help reduce downtime and improve overall server reliability.

How Version 2 can help with the server maintenance checklist

Are you a business with 10 to 100 employees looking to improve your server maintenance process? If you're growing and need a structured way to manage updates, backups, and server performance, we can help.

At Version 2, we specialize in helping businesses build and follow a reliable server maintenance checklist. Our team handles everything from setup to ongoing support, so you can focus on running your business. Let’s talk about how we can support your IT needs.

[.c-button-wrap][.c-button-main][.c-button-icon-content]Contact Us[.c-button-icon][.c-button-icon][.c-button-icon-content][.c-button-main][.c-button-wrap]

Frequently asked questions

What should I include in a basic server maintenance checklist?

A basic checklist should cover updates, backups, and server management tasks. Include steps like checking logs, monitoring disk usage, and applying software updates. These help reduce downtime and keep your server running smoothly.

Also, don’t forget to change your password policies regularly and test your data backup process. These simple steps can prevent major issues later.

How often should I update my server software?

You should update your server software at least once a month. This includes OS patches, control panel updates, and application fixes. Regular maintenance ensures your system stays secure and compatible.

Use remote management tools to automate updates when possible. This saves time and reduces the risk of missing critical patches.

Why is server backup important for small businesses?

Backups protect your data from hardware failure, cyberattacks, or accidental deletion. For small businesses, losing data can mean lost revenue or customer trust. A reliable backup system is essential.

Make sure to back up your hard drive daily and store copies offsite. Test your restore process regularly to ensure it works.

How do I monitor server logs effectively?

Set up automated tools to collect and analyze server logs. Focus on login attempts, error messages, and unusual activity. This helps you catch issues early.

Monitoring logs also improves server performance by identifying slow processes or failing services. It’s a key part of regular maintenance.

What’s the difference between Windows Server and Linux Server maintenance?

Windows Server often uses a graphical control panel, while Linux Server relies on command-line tools. Maintenance tasks are similar but use different methods.

For example, software updates and log file locations differ between the two. Choose tools and templates that match your server OS.

How do I create a server maintenance checklist for 2026?

Start by reviewing your current checklist and identifying gaps. Add new tasks based on updated best practices and compliance rules. Use a server maintenance checklist template to stay organized.

Include tasks like reviewing server resource usage, updating passwords, and checking the server room environment. Keep your server ready for the year ahead.